EnergyGuide Label
Most new major appliances have bright yellow EnergyGuide Labels that shows how much energy the product uses. The label also tells how much energy that appliance will use in a year, compared to competing brands and models. The next time you shop for an appliance, take along the explantantion below to understand the label.

And be sure to take your calculator with you. Calculate the additional cost of an energy-efficient appliance over it's lifetime, not just on the purchase price. New refrigerators, freezers and washers may last up to 15 years. So if the energy-efficient model costs $150 more, you'll only be spending an extra $10 per year in effect. And the appliance will likely save you an amount equal to or greater than that each year in elelctric usage.
